The Associate Director, Product Security Lifecycle will be supporting Global Research & Development Product Development. You will be responsible for leading all aspects of and managing the end-to-end Alcon Product Security Lifecycle efforts from strategy, developing, and implementing product security processes for medical devices and digital solutions. A key aspect of this role is to manage and ensure products comply with the cybersecurity pre-market and post-market activities and to support governance, compliance, and risk management initiatives. In this role, a typical day will include:

  • Manage overall governance, compliance, and risk management processes for the product security and privacy program.
  • Manage and sustain the Alcon Product Security Process (APSP) and related policies, procedure and standards, and other internal Alcon standard operating procedures (SOPs).
  • Simplify as relevant the APSP processes and procedures and ensure continuous security enablement with global regulatory requirements and frameworks.
  • Enable product security post-market processes (operations, incident management, change management processes, etc.).
  • Facilitate and lead where relevant the product security audits, third party assessment, and compliance initiatives and meet internal stakeholder requirements (HIPAA, UL 2900, and Quality, Regulatory, etc.).
  • Lead global product security engagement in meeting registration filing needs working closely with regulatory teams.
  • Ensure consistency across customer security documentation as needed.
  • Develop internal and external product security materials including training and awareness, product-specific materials, security guides, labeling needs, and other technical materials.
  • Collaborate with Alcon cross-functional team to support process improvements and automation as needed including common artifacts, tools implementation, security portals, etc.
  • Building capabilities, tools, including automation to drive improvements for Alcon product security process and practices.
  • Providing guidance and training to product development teams on product security best practices and processes.
  • Staying up to date with the latest global product security standards, frameworks, and global regulations
  • Support quantification of security/privacy risks and readouts to senior leadership
Preferred Qualifications:

  • Industry experience in a regulated environment. Preferred to have a Medical Device, MedTech, or health care experience.
  • Experience in the delivery and execution of product security processes, standards, best practices, and tools.
  • Application of global privacy compliance, security regulations across software development lifecycle
  • Creative ways to apply process management best practices to enable teams to operate more efficiently.
  • Experience in program/project management in cybersecurity initiatives.
WHAT YOU'LL BRING TO ALCON:

  • Bachelor's Degree or equivalent years of directly related experience (or high school +13 yrs; Assoc.+9 yrs; M.S.+2 yrs; PhD+0 yrs)
  • The ability to fluently read, write, understand, and communicate in English.
  • 5+ Years of Relevant Experience in cybersecurity processes, frameworks, regulations (FDA/MDR/HIPAA etc.)
  • Working knowledge in cybersecurity processes, frameworks, regulations and product/software development process, agile processes, etc.
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ate and collaborate effectively with Global teams.
